Collegedale Police Department The Daily Highlight Report Thursday, June 23rd, 2022

A South District resident reported that someone had ran from behind their residence. Officers checked the area around the home and found no evidence of anyone being there. 

A traffic stop in the 10100 block of Lee Highway led to the driver being charged with driving on a  suspended license.

A sandwich was reported stolen from a West District convenience store. 

EMS transported an elderly patient that had suffered several falls from their assisted living facility to the hospital. 

EMS responded to an East District residence for an individual who had suffered a seizure. The individual refused treatment and transport. 

A Collegedale fugitive was booked on their warrants. 

Officers responded to a disagreement between a West District business clerk and a potential customer.

A crash report was made after a vehicle struck a deer in the 10600 block of Apison Pike. 

EMS responded to an individual having difficulty breathing in the West District. 

A two vehicle crash was reported in the 5600 block of Little Debbie Parkway. There were no injuries. 

A traffic stop in the 8800 block of Old Lee Highway led to an occupant’s arrest for a warrant out of Sequatchie County. Officer’s transferred custody of the prisoner to Sequatchie County deputies at the county line. 

A theft report was taken after an individual discovered that their wallet had been stolen while they had been at the coin laundry in the Crossroads Plaza.
